出租车计价器设计代码,出租车计价器eda设计
作者:admin 发布时间:2024-02-06 02:45 分类:资讯 浏览:24 评论:0
求单片机大神指导程序啊,这是出租车计价器的user部分的程序,看不太懂...
1、bit TIMER_FLAGE = 0; ?--定义位变量TIMER_FLAGE,并赋值0 bit DIDPL_FLAGE = 0; ?定义位变量DIDPL_FLAGE,并赋值0 Timer_Com%10 == 0 是判断Timer_Com是否是10,20 等是否是被10整除的数据。
2、首先要看里程传感器的输出是模拟的还是数字的。无论何种里程传感器,可以用数字积分器,简单些;也可以用模拟积分器,这样设计和调试的难度就很大。
3、SMOD是串行口波特率倍增位,当SMOD=1时,串行口波特率加倍。系统复位默认为SMOD=0。其他位没什么意义,不用太关心。至于程序,注释已经很多了,应该很容易看懂的呀,PCON=0x80,说明设置的波特率在原参数基础上加倍。
出租车计价器设计
首先要看里程传感器的输出是模拟的还是数字的。无论何种里程传感器,可以用数字积分器,简单些;也可以用模拟积分器,这样设计和调试的难度就很大。
方案三:采用Atmel公司的AT89S52单片机作为主控制器,此单片机是51内核的CMOS 8位单片机,片内含8k空间的可反复擦些1000次的Flash读写存储器,具有256 bytes的随机存取数据存储器(RAM),32个IO口,你知道厂房装修合同样板。
设计原理与实现方案论证里程计数及显示 在出租车转轴上加装传感器,以便获得“行驶里程信号”。设汽车每走1Km发一个脉冲,里程的计数显示,可用十进制、译码显示。
出租车计价器的显示器按计价器项目设置至少设4个屏。根据出租汽车计价器检定规程,计价器显示屏至少有4个显示窗口,包括金额屏,单价屏,计程屏,计时屏。
EDA课程设计,用VHDL编程做出租车计费器
系统有两个脉冲输入信号clk_750k,fin,其中clk_750k将根据设计要求分频成14hz,15hz和1hz分别作为公里计费和超时计费的脉冲。
模323计数器设计实验报告实验内容在QuartusII平台上,利用VHDL代码实现学号323计数器的设计,并在三位数码管显示出来。实验步骤与过程分析建立工程。
本课题所研制的出租车计费系统从设计原理上综合了传统的硬件电路,采用VHDL语言和自顶而下的设计方法,大大缩短了研究的时间周期,易于做设计的修改和把相应的修改并入设计文件中。
给你提供点思路吧。这东西我写过不难就是几个计数器,建议你用case when语句。这个语句学会了很多程序都可以用这个语句来写。
基于单片机的出租车计价系统{C语言编程}
本设计通过运用单片机设计的出租车计价器,简单易懂,是学习电子课程的一个综合性实验,有助于提高分析问题能力。
本题要求根据某城市普通出租车收费标准编写程序进行车费计算。
我对输入的公里 和 分钟都定义成整型了,比如输入2,默认为3公里或者3分钟,因为我印象里出租车跑不够整公里,就不加钱。
起步价10元,可以行驶3km,超出3km外的每1km按8元算(题目没说清楚不足一公里按一公里算,但一般都是按一公里算)。
针对AT89C52单片机,头文件AT89x5h给出了SFR特殊功能寄存器所有端口的定义。教科书的160页给出了针对MCS51系列单片机的C语言扩展变量类型。C语言编程基础:十六进制表示字节0x5a:二进制为01011010B;0x6E为01101110。
- 上一篇:五自由度机械手设计,五自由度机械臂设计
- 下一篇:光明与黑暗设计,光明与黑暗设计理念
相关推荐
你 发表评论:
欢迎- 资讯排行
- 标签列表
- 友情链接